Output 99b7a3f13078d70ce8e4ead694750d33bb8e5f315ece2e9c06709821a9ba8587:0

value
1003649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d623c2a73a28f54f453de4fee0028c91375f19 OP_EQUAL
address
3EoZ5fLzMDcztLbkGAnHZGQwSmeFpAwk5o
transaction
99b7a3f13078d70ce8e4ead694750d33bb8e5f315ece2e9c06709821a9ba8587
spent
true